In-form Batley on a high

James Gordon

Batley General Manager Paul Harrison is hoping to capitalise on the feel-good factor surrounding the club, as they hunt a sixth straight victory this weekend.

The Bulldogs are right on the tails of Championship leaders Leigh after an impressive run of wins, and meet the Centurions live on SKY Sports in a few weeks.

Harrison told the club’s official website: “As you can imagine the mood throughout the club is brilliant, right through from our ground staff up to the Chairman and Directors. And I’m sure all Bulldog fans are enjoying going to work Monday morning with a great big smile on their faces talking about the weekend’s performance.

“We have got lots of promotions going on for this game (against Leigh) so hopefully the Batley public will get behind the team.

“I’m sure it will be a very hard fought game, when we played Leigh earlier in the season they were playing really really well and still are. But I’m sure they won’t be looking forward to playing us at The Mount, especially with us winning our last 5 games on the bounce.”
